Rep. Virgil Goode (R-Prester
John's kingdom) has
taken to the pages of USA Today to showcase his particular
version of "damage control." It's a brand new year when people may
be ready to forget his jihad against Muslim Rep. Keith Ellison and
Muslim immigration in general. What's Goode write?
Let us remember that we were not attacked by a nation on 9/11; we were attacked by extremists who acted in the name of the Islamic religion. I believe that if we do not stop illegal immigration totally, reduce legal immigration and end diversity visas, we are leaving ourselves vulnerable to infiltration by those who want to mold the United States into the image of their religion, rather than working within the Judeo-Christian principles that have made us a beacon for freedom-loving persons around the world.
OK. Look. As Ronald Bailey (who has the pleasure of being represented by Goode in Congress) pointed out, Rep. Ellison is not an immigrant. He's a black Minnesotan who converted to Islam. And it's worth pointing out that this convert to Islamism has avoided helping terrorists infiltrate the U.S. or plant bombs in the IDS Center. He's, you know, assimiliated into the political mainstream. But he wants to make a token nod to his faith as he's sworn in, so let's get ready to send a surge of troops in to democratize Minneapolis or something.
